ORCL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2021 in Review

2,096 of the 5,745 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Oracle (ORCL) for Q2 2021, worth a combined $97.5B — up 4.7% from $93.1B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 153 funds opened new ORCL positions and 77 closed out — a net gain of 76 holders — while 660 added to existing stakes and 968 trimmed.

The largest buyer was JP Morgan Chase, adding an estimated $630M. The largest seller was BlackRock, cutting an estimated $406M.
